<title>net: phylink: use a dedicated helper to parse usgmii control word</title>

Q-USGMII is a derivative of USGMII, that uses a specific formatting for
the control word. The layout is close to the USXGMII control word, but
doesn't support speeds over 1Gbps. Use a dedicated decoding logic for
the USGMII control word, re-using USXGMII definitions but only considering
10/100/1000Mbps speeds

<title>net: sfp: fix state loss when updating state_hw_mask</title>

Andrew reports that the SFF modules on one of the ZII platforms do not
indicate link up due to the SFP code believing that LOS indicating that
there is no signal being received from the remote end, but in fact the
LOS signal is showing that there is signal.

What makes SFF modules different from SFPs is they typically have an
inverted LOS, which uncovered this issue. When we read the hardware
state, we mask it with state_hw_mask so we ignore anything we're not
interested in. However, we don't re-read when state_hw_mask changes,
leading to sfp-&gt;state being stale.

Arrange for a software poll of the module state after we have parsed
the EEPROM in sfp_sm_mod_probe() and updated state_*_mask. This will
generate any necessary events for signal changes for the state
machine as well as updating sfp-&gt;state.

<title>net: phy: dp83867: add w/a for packet errors seen with short cables</title>

Introduce the W/A for packet errors seen with short cables (&lt;1m) between
two DP83867 PHYs.

The W/A recommended by DM requires FFE Equalizer Configuration tuning by
writing value 0x0E81 to DSP_FFE_CFG register (0x012C), surrounded by hard
and soft resets as follows:

write_reg(0x001F, 0x8000); //hard reset
write_reg(DSP_FFE_CFG, 0x0E81);
write_reg(0x001F, 0x4000); //soft reset

Since  DP83867 PHY DM says "Changing this register to 0x0E81, will not
affect Long Cable performance.", enable the W/A by default.

<title>net: sfp: add quirk enabling 2500Base-x for HG MXPD-483II</title>

The HG MXPD-483II 1310nm SFP module is meant to operate with 2500Base-X,
however, in their EEPROM they incorrectly specify:
    Transceiver type                          : Ethernet: 1000BASE-LX
    ...
    BR, Nominal                               : 2600MBd

Use sfp_quirk_2500basex for this module to allow 2500Base-X mode anyway.

<title>net: phy: nxp-c45-tja11xx: fix unsigned long multiplication overflow</title>

Any multiplication between GENMASK(31, 0) and a number bigger than 1
will be truncated because of the overflow, if the size of unsigned long
is 32 bits.

Replaced GENMASK with GENMASK_ULL to make sure that multiplication will
be between 64 bits values.
